COOKING CONDITION
MICROWAVE COOKING CONDITION
The followings are the complete microwave cooking
operation; (Figure 1.)
A. Full Power Condition
When the variable cooking mode selector is set fully
right (“Full Power” position) and the cook switch
is depressed, the following operation occurs;
A-l.The turntable motor, microwave timer motor,
microwave indicator light and vari-motor are
energized.
A-2.The surge limiting relay is energized through the
vari-swi tch.
A-3. The 220 volts A.C. is supplied to a primary
winding of the power transformer through the
vari-switch and surge limiting relay contacts (15)
(16).
A-4.The power transformer converts 3.2 volts A.C.
output on the filament winding and approximately
2400 volts A.C. on the high voltage winding.
A-5.The 3.2 volts A.C. output from filament winding
heats the magnetron filament.
A-6.The 2400 volts A.C. output from the secondary
winding is sent to a voltage doubler circuit
consisting of a high voltage capacitor and a silicon
rectifier.
The 2400 volts A.C. is converted to approximately
4000 negative D.C. voltage (peak to peak) by the
voltage doubler circuit and sent to the magnetron
assembly.
A-7.The negative 4000 volts D.C. is applied to the
cathode of the magnetron tube. This causes it to
oscillate and produce a 2450 MHz cooking fre-
quency.
A-8.The RF energy produced by the magnetron tube is
channeled through a waveguide into the cavity
feedbox, and then into the cavity where the food
is placed to be heated.
A-9.Upon completion of the selected cooking time, the
timer bell rings once and the timer switch is
deactivated. The oven is reverted to the off
condition.
B. Defrost, Simmer and Roast Condition
When the cook switch is depressed and the variable
cooking mode selector is set to “DEFROST”,
“SIMMER” or “ROAST” position, the following
operation occurs;
B- 1. Above A- 1, A-2 and A-3 operations occur.
B-2.The vari-motor rotates at (2) r.p.m. In case the
mode selector is set at “DEFROST”, the 220
volts A.C. is supplied intermittently to the surge
limiting relay through the vari-switch and the
power transformer through the vari-switch and
surge limiting relay contacts (lS)-( 16).
The vari-switch ‘is operated, at a 9 seconds ON
and 21 seconds OFF repetition rate, by means of
the cam provided on the vari-motor shaft.
The repetition rate for others are as follows;
SIMMER: 15 seconds ON, 15 seconds OFF
ROAST:
21 seconds ON, 9 seconds OFF
B-3. The 3.2 and 2400 volts A.C. outputs are converted
while the 220 volts A.C. is supplied to the power
transformer.
B-4. Then above A-5, A-6, A-7, A-8 and A-9 operations
occur.
BROWNING CONDITION
When the browner timer is set and the cook switch is
depressed, the following operation occurs;
2-1. The turntable motor, browner timer motor and
browner indicator light are energized.
2-2. The 220 volts A.C. is supplied to the browning
element.
2-3. Upon completion of the selected cooking time, the
timer bell rings once as the timer switch is
deactivated and the oven reverts to the off condi-
tion.
Note: When both microwave and browner timers are set,
microwave energy is produced first. In this case,
the browning element will be activated when the
microwave timer returns to “0” position.
